ت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
اريد حلا ارجوكم وبسرعة
#1
Star 
"""  Invalid attempt to call Read when reader is closed   "".المشكله هي 
                Dim s As String = " Select *  from SOlaf_Qared_1  where Account_No = '" & Me.Account_No_Txt.Text
                If oledbcon.State = ConnectionState.Open Then oledbcon.Close()
                oledbcon.Open()
                Dim cmd As New SqlCommand(s, oledbcon)
                Dim rdr As SqlDataReader = cmd.ExecuteReader
                While rdr.Read
                    If Not IsDBNull(rdr("DATE_DAY")) Then Me.Date_Day_DB.Text = rdr("DATE_DAY")
                    If Not IsDBNull(rdr("MANTAKA_NO")) Then cnn1 = rdr("MANTAKA_NO")
                    'If Not IsDBNull(rdr("MANTAKA_Name")) Then Me.Mantaka_Name_Cb.Text = rdr("MANTAKA_Name")
                    If Not IsDBNull(rdr("BRANCH_NO")) Then cnn2 = rdr("BRANCH_NO")
                    'If Not IsDBNull(rdr("BRANCH_Name")) Then Me.Branch_Name_Cb.Text = rdr("BRANCH_Name")
                    If Not IsDBNull(rdr("MADEEN_NAME")) Then Me.Madeen_Name_Txt.Text = rdr("MADEEN_NAME")
                    If Not IsDBNull(rdr("ID_NO")) Then Me.Id_No_Txt.Text = rdr("ID_NO")
                    If Not IsDBNull(rdr("MADEEN_ADDRE")) Then Me.MADEEN_ADDRE_Txt.Text = rdr("MADEEN_ADDRE")
                    If Not IsDBNull(rdr("TASHEL_VAL")) Then Me.Tashel_Val_Mxt.Text = rdr("TASHEL_VAL")
                    If Not IsDBNull(rdr("GRANT_DATE")) Then Me.Grant_date_db.Text = rdr("GRANT_DATE")
                    If Not IsDBNull(rdr("TERM_DATE")) Then Me.Term_date_db.Text = rdr("TERM_DATE")
                    If Not IsDBNull(rdr("DAMANAT")) Then Me.Damanat_Cb.Text = rdr("DAMANAT")
                    If Not IsDBNull(rdr("ACT_TYPE")) Then Me.Act_Case_CB.Text = rdr("ACT_TYPE")
                    If Not IsDBNull(rdr("EHALA_DATE")) Then Me.Ehala_date_db.Text = rdr("EHALA_DATE").ToString
                    If Not IsDBNull(rdr("REMARK")) Then Me.REMARK_Txt.Text = rdr("REMARK")
                    If Not IsDBNull(rdr("EHALA_RASED")) Then Me.Elhali_rased_Mxt.Text = rdr("EHALA_RASED")
                    If Not IsDBNull(rdr("HAGEZ_NO")) Then Me.HAGEZ_NO_Txt.Text = rdr("HAGEZ_NO")
                    If Not IsDBNull(rdr("ESDAR_DATE")) Then Me.ESDAR_DATE_db.Text = rdr("ESDAR_DATE")
                    If Not IsDBNull(rdr("HAGEZ_PRICE")) Then Me.HAGEZ_PRICE_mxt.Text = rdr("HAGEZ_PRICE")
                    If Not IsDBNull(rdr("EGRAT")) Then Me.EGRAT_Txt.Text = rdr("EGRAT")
                    If Not IsDBNull(rdr("MOSADAD")) Then Me.Mosadad_Mxt.Text = rdr("MOSADAD")
                    If Not IsDBNull(rdr("Ejra_Motaked")) Then Me.Ejra_Motaked_cb.Text = rdr("Ejra_Motaked")
                    If Not IsDBNull(rdr("Ejra_Motked_Date")) Then Me.Ejra_Motked_Date.Text = rdr("Ejra_Motked_Date")
                    If Not IsDBNull(rdr("Full_Value_Tas")) Then Me.Full_Value_Tas_Txt.Text = rdr("Full_Value_Tas")
                    Me.Serch_BrN_Txt.Text = cnn2
                    '************************************************************************************************
                    'If oledbcon.State = ConnectionState.Open Then oledbcon.Close()
                    'oledbcon.Open()
                    Dim s111 As String = " Select *  from MANATEK_TABLE where MANTAKA_NO = '" & cnn1 & "'  "
                    Dim cmd111 As New SqlCommand(s111, oledbcon)
                    rdr.Close()
                    Dim rdr111 As SqlDataReader = cmd111.ExecuteReader
                    Angry Angry Angry While rdr111.Read
                        If (rdr111.HasRows = True) Then
                            Me.Mantaka_Name_Cb.Text = rdr111(1)
                        End If
                    End While
الرد }}}}
تم الشكر بواسطة:
#2
الأملا rdr.Close المفروض يكون في النهاية
يعني انقله بعد End While
الرد }}}}
تم الشكر بواسطة:
#3
(17-10-16, 01:17 PM)mhmd_911 كتب : الأملا rdr.Close المفروض يكون في النهاية
يعني انقله بعد  End While

اهلا اخي جربته لكن المشكلة مستمرة
الرد }}}}
تم الشكر بواسطة:
#4
هذا الكلام امس

انا لما شفتك "اريد حلا ارجوكم وبسرعة"
قلت اخونا في حاجة مساعدة مستعجلة

رديت عليك وانتظرتك ترد بالنتيجة،

لكن للاسف تجاهلتني
الرد }}}}
تم الشكر بواسطة:
#5
(18-10-16, 11:25 AM)mhmd_911 كتب : هذا الكلام امس

انا لما شفتك "اريد حلا ارجوكم وبسرعة"
قلت اخونا في حاجة مساعدة مستعجلة

رديت عليك وانتظرتك ترد بالنتيجة،

لكن للاسف تجاهلتني

لا انا لم اتجاهل غير انشغلت بايجاد حل للمشكلة شكرا اخي
الرد }}}}
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  [سؤال] اريد مثال على طريقة ادراج صورة من السكانر ناصر شير 0 20 20-02-17, 02:45 PM
آخر رد: ناصر شير
Question [سؤال] اريد حل لهذه المشكلة دعم العربية shwehdi4pc 1 81 11-02-17, 02:35 AM
آخر رد: مساعدة
  اريد كود تنسيق التاريخ bidaya 10 245 06-02-17, 03:08 AM
آخر رد: bidaya
  اريد select check item --- alwasela 4 91 31-01-17, 02:08 AM
آخر رد: محمد كريّم
  اريد طريقة الاتصال المباشر بقاعدة بيانات اكسس abudawoodd 0 87 30-01-17, 02:58 PM
آخر رد: abudawoodd
  [VB.NET] اريد عمل مثل هذا الاتصال 3asfa~mdmra 4 146 29-01-17, 11:08 PM
آخر رد: 3asfa~mdmra
  [سؤال] اريد طريقة لمنع تكرار عناصر listbox riad21 2 96 25-01-17, 04:06 PM
آخر رد: riad21
  اريد تحول الكود لفيجوال 2008 abudawoodd 6 237 15-01-17, 02:11 PM
آخر رد: abudawoodd
  اريد كود غلق الفورم الحالى وفتح فورم اخر ali.alfoly 8 3,173 04-01-17, 09:18 PM
آخر رد: jojo2014
  مساعده اريد كود لحذف عدد من الصفوف من الداتا قرد فيو وكذلك تنحذف من قاعدة البيانات معتز الجازوي 2 156 25-12-16, 01:44 PM
آخر رد: thevirus

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م